Integrated Pharmacist

We seek an Integrated Pharmacist to join our NICU pharmacy team. Related Pediatrics-Critical Care experience is required and must have a PGY1 Residency minimum to be considered.

  • Fills and labels prescriptions, and provides drug-related information and education for in-patients, out-patients, hospital employees, and medical staff.
  • Dispenses controlled substances and maintains appropriate inventory records.
  • Supervises the activities of the pharmacy technical staff and Mentors or trains pharmacists, pharmacy students, or residents.
  • Participates in the Medication Use Evaluation Program and the Process Improvement Program.
  • Maintains medication profiles, reviews profiles for drug-related problems, and provides consultation on drug research.
  • Maintains the scheduling and preparation of I.V. solutions and additives.
  • Initiates reports of medication errors or adverse drug interactions.
  • Assumes full responsibility for department management in the absence of the Pharmacy Manager or Lead Pharmacist.
  • Works with other professionals to generate newsletters. Draft policies or procedures for review by the Pharmacy Director.
  • Performs clinical interventions, which may include medication profile review, IV to oral conversion, renal dosing adjustment, antimicrobial streamlining, patient counseling, obtaining medication histories, vancomycin/aminoglycoside dosing, therapeutic drug monitoring, and participation in multidisciplinary rounds.
  • Documents clinical interventions.
  • Ensures safe care to patients, staff, and visitors; adheres to all Memorial Hermann policies, procedures, and standards within budgetary specifications including time management, supply management, productivity, and quality of service.
  • Promotes individual professional growth and development by meeting requirements for mandatory/continuing education and skills competency; supports department-based goals that contribute to the success of the organization; serves as preceptor, mentor, and resource to less experienced staff.
  • Other duties as assigned.

· Education: Graduate of an accredited School of Pharmacy

· Licenses/Certifications: Licensed as a Registered Pharmacist in the State of Texas; Pharmacy Sterile Product certification through an in-house program or other accredited program is required

· Experience / Knowledge / Skills:

  • Two (2) years of experience as a hospital Pharmacist (or at the discretion of the System Executive, System Pharmacy) with knowledge of the unit dose medication and I.V. admixture processes
